The logistics multinational, ID Logistics Brazil, with a strong presence in e-commerce, had an average growth of 28.5% this year, above the expected on Black Friday. The company aimed at an overall increase of 25% in the volume of orders for all sectors. But the logistics sector for fashion operations exceeded expectations well. The numbers even reinforce ID Logistics expertise in fashion, which was one of the sectors most served by Black Friday this year.
In one of the operations, for example, one of the retail distribution centers fashion came to have a significant growth of 30% for the date. And on the main day of Black Friday, November 29, one of the companies that ID Logistics operates all logistics had the highest turnover in history in a single day.
The main and challenging measure of the strategy for Black Friday, drawn up in June together with its customers in the segment, was the hiring of temporary employees for an area that already suffers from a labor deficit ¡n recent times the operator released notice with more than 2 thousand vacancies, to assist logistics with a chance of hiring.
The number of employees of the operation also grew 34% in the framework of this year for the Black Friday campaign, counting on vacancies of temporary logistics assistants. Another important measure was the provision of equipment, such as radio frequency collector, forklifts, uniforms and PPE, among others, if necessary.
To achieve the growth goal and even overcome, the strategy that contemplates the synergy between different distribution centers, and even for the same warehouse for the rapid displacement of employees and equipment was used.
In retail, another area of activity of ID Logistics, the work focused on October to supply the stores, mainly with electronics items, white line, televisions, among others. In this case, the increase in volumes was found to be about 10% .
